Listed Building record MDO10345 - Minterne Magna School, Minterne Magna.

Summary
Formerly a School, now house. Dated 1860, it is built of rubble walls and has a slated, gable-ended roof. Ashlar dressings. Bell-cote to right gable, cross wing left, gabled porch right. Single storey, 3 window range with 2 storey gabled cross wing. Square headed stone mullioned windows, each light having a 4-centred head. Cast-iron casements with diamond pattern panes. Porch bears date stone.
